Nokia might launch its penta-lens camera phone in February 2019


We recently reported that Nokia might be planning to launch a new phone with 5 lenses. Dubbed as Nokia 9, the device was rumoured to launch sometime this year.

However, a recent leak revealed that the Nokia 9 might make debut during MWC 2019. The device is supposed to come with top of the line specs and 5 lens camera on the back. As usual, the lenses will be designed by Carl Zeiss. With the latest leak, it’s at least confirmed that Nokia is working on a penta-lens camera setup. As for the specs, Nokia 9 might come with Snapdragon 855, at least 6 GB of RAM and 64 GB of storage. However, do note that these specs aren’t leaked and might not be true.
